Economic Implications of Accelerated Nuclear Power Plant Construction
The economic implications of speeding up nuclear power plant construction are complex and multifaceted, requiring a thorough cost-benefit analysis.
Cost-Benefit Analysis
A faster construction timeline could theoretically lead to cost savings.
- Reduced Labor Costs: Potentially lower overall labor costs due to shorter project durations. However, this may be offset by the need to employ a larger workforce simultaneously.
- Economies of Scale: Streamlined processes and bulk purchasing could generate economies of scale, reducing material costs. However, rushing the process can negate these advantages.
- Risk of Cost Overruns: Accelerated schedules increase the risk of cost overruns due to potential errors, rework, and unforeseen complications. This is a significant concern, as nuclear power plant projects are already notoriously expensive. Data from past projects shows a high incidence of cost overruns in rushed constructions.
Job Creation and Economic Stimulus
An accelerated program would create substantial job opportunities.
- Construction Jobs: Thousands of jobs would be created directly in construction, engineering, and project management.
- Related Industries: Supporting industries, including manufacturing, transportation, and services, would also experience a boost in activity.
- Long-Term Economic Benefits: Operational nuclear power plants contribute to the economy through electricity generation, tax revenue, and long-term employment. However, the initial economic boost must be weighed against potential long-term liabilities.
Safety and Regulatory Concerns in Expedited Nuclear Power Plant Construction
The pursuit of speed in nuclear power plant construction necessitates careful consideration of safety and regulatory compliance.
Regulatory Hurdles and Streamlining
Navigating the regulatory process is a significant challenge for nuclear projects.
- Compromised Safety Standards: Accelerated timelines could necessitate compromises on safety standards if regulatory approvals are rushed.
- Nuclear Regulatory Commission (NRC) Oversight: The NRC's role in ensuring safety remains crucial, and any attempts to circumvent its procedures are problematic.
- Public Perception and Concerns: Public trust is vital for nuclear power projects. An overly hasty approach could fuel public anxieties and opposition. Transparency and effective public communication are essential.
Construction Quality and Safety Protocols
Expediting construction could compromise safety protocols.
- Increased Risk of Accidents: Rushed work increases the risk of human error and accidents during construction and operation.
- Cutting Corners on Safety Measures: Pressure to meet deadlines might tempt companies to cut corners on safety procedures.
- Importance of Rigorous Quality Control: Maintaining rigorous quality control is paramount throughout the entire construction process to mitigate risks. Independent audits are vital.
Technological Advancements and Their Role in Accelerated Nuclear Power Plant Construction
Technological innovation could potentially alleviate some of the challenges associated with accelerated construction.
Modular Construction and Pre-fabrication
Modular construction offers potential time savings.
- Off-site Construction: Significant portions of the plant can be prefabricated off-site, reducing on-site construction time.
- Reduced On-site Work: This minimizes weather delays and streamlines the overall process.
- Improved Quality Control: Factory-controlled environments enhance quality control and reduce errors. Several successful modular nuclear projects demonstrate this approach's viability.
Advanced Reactor Designs
Next-generation reactor designs offer advantages in terms of construction time.
- Smaller Reactor Sizes: Smaller reactors are inherently simpler and faster to construct than traditional large-scale plants.
- Simpler Designs: Simplified designs reduce construction complexity and the potential for errors.
- Reduced Construction Complexity: This leads to quicker assembly and commissioning. Small Modular Reactors (SMRs) are prime examples of this technology.
Political Landscape and Public Opinion on Accelerated Nuclear Power Plant Construction
The political landscape and public opinion significantly influence the feasibility of an accelerated construction timeline.
Trump Administration's Energy Policy
The Trump administration's energy policy prioritized energy independence.
- Energy Independence Goals: Accelerated nuclear power plant construction was seen as a means to achieve this goal, reducing reliance on foreign energy sources.
- Influence of Lobbying Groups: The influence of pro-nuclear energy lobbying groups played a role in shaping the administration's policy.
- Bipartisan Support: While the Trump administration championed the initiative, bipartisan support for nuclear power is not uniform, varying with specific concerns.
Public Perception and Acceptance
Public opinion on nuclear power is complex and includes safety and waste disposal concerns.
- Concerns about Nuclear Waste Disposal: Safe and permanent disposal of nuclear waste remains a significant public concern.
- Safety Fears: Accidents at nuclear power plants, such as Chernobyl and Fukushima, continue to fuel safety fears.
- Potential for Public Protests and Opposition: A lack of transparency and public engagement can lead to strong opposition and protests against such projects.
